Join us as STALSEN presents a compelling case for rethinking hand protection.
Explore common causes of hand injuries and discover the STALSEN approach to reducing them. Following on to an educational deep dive into the cut resistance standards (EN 388), reviewing the old standards and how adopting the new standards will improve hand safety. Finishing with a brief overview of the technical properties of gloves and an explanation of the traditional misconceptions.
